Title: Analysis of liquid-based cytology and histological examination with of high-risk HPV-positive patients 523 cases
Abstract: Objective To study the relationship between thinprep cytologic test and the types of human papilloma virus(HPV) infection in cervical precancerous lesion screening.Method To perform high-risk HPV types test in 523 samples.Choose positive samples to take thinprep cytologic test(TCT) and directed biopsies under biopsy.Results NILM rate for TCT was 40%(209/523),ASCUS and above rate for TCT was 60%(314/523).There was no statistically significant difference in the viral loads of HPV infection rate between the TCT negative patients and positive patients(P0.5).Positive correspondence rate for TCT and biopsy were 75.2%(128/170),91.4%(53/58),and 100%(12/12).Conclusion High-risk HPV types checking combined with TCT and biopsy can raise the positive rate significantly.It should be used as a reliable method for early diagnosis in cervical cancer and CIN screening.
